Jmm. Millet, FEPO CATALYSTS FOR THE SELECTIVE OXIDATIVE DEHYDROGENATION OF ISOBUTYRIC ACID INTO METHACRYLIC-ACID, Catalysis reviews. Science and engineering, 40(1-2), 1998, pp. 1-38
This review presents the iron phosphorus oxides used as catalysts for
isobutyric acid oxidative dehydrogenation. Research on this catalytic
system has been developed in the last decade and many publications hav
e been devoted to this reaction, as it can be a step in a new process
of production of methyl methacrylate. We emphasize particularly the na
ture of the active phase, the active centers, and the role of water an
d promoters. The mechanistic aspects of the reaction, which correspond
s to an extension of the Mars and van Krevelen mechanism with a specia
l role of water partial pressure, are discussed.
